Huntsman Announces Officer Changes: Tony Hankins to Retire and Steen Weien Hansen Named Division President, Huntsman Polyurethanes
Rhea-AI Summary
Huntsman Corporation (NYSE: HUN) announced key leadership changes in its Polyurethanes division. Tony Hankins, Division President of Polyurethanes, will retire at the end of 2025 after a career spanning over 40 years. Steen Weien Hansen, currently Senior Vice President overseeing global automotive, elastomers, and Americas business units, will succeed Hankins as Division President effective June 1, 2025.
Hansen, who joined through the acquisition of ICI's polyurethanes division in 1999, brings over 20 years of experience with the company, including leadership roles in Asia Pacific, Europe, India, and Middle East regions. Hankins will continue advising senior management and the Board through December 31, 2025, ensuring a smooth transition.
